Introduction :

The lytic cycle involves reproducing viruses using a host cell to create more viruses; then, the viruses burst out of the cell. This is commonly referred to as the reproductive cycle which involves virus attachment, penetration, viral genome transcription, virion biosynthesis, and then host cell lysis.
